Westos 第一次练习题

本文详细介绍了如何在Linux环境下使用shell命令批量创建、移动、复制和删除文件,包括利用通配符和范围指定来精细化控制文件操作,适用于系统管理员和高级用户进行高效文件管理。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

  • 用一条命令建立12个文件WESTOS_classX_linuxY(X的数值范围为1-2,Y的范围为1-6)
 	# touch WESTOS_class{1..2}_linux{1..6}
  • 这些文件都包含在root用户桌面的study目录中
	# mkdir study
	# mv WESTOS_class{1..2}_linux{1..6} study
  • 用一条命令建立8个文件redhat_versionX(x的范围为1-8)
	# touch redhat_version{1..8}
  • redhat_virsionX这些文件都包含在/tmp目录中的version中
	# mkdir /tmp/version
	# mv redhat_version{1..8} /tmp/version
  • 管理刚才新建立的文件要求如下
  • 用一条命令把redhat_cersionX 中的带有奇数的文件复制到桌面的SINGLE中
	# mkdir SINGLE
	# cp /tmp/version/redhat_version[1,3,5,7] SINGLE
  • 用一条命令把redhat_cersionX 中的带有偶数的文件复制到/DOUBLE中
	# mkdir DOUBLE
	# cp /tmp/version/redhat_version[2,4,6,8] DOUBLE
  • 用一条命令把WESTOS_classX_linuxY中class1的文件移动到当前用户桌面的CLASS1中
	# mkdir CLASS1
	# mv study/WESTOS_class1_linux{1..6}
  • 用一条命令把WESTOS_classX_linuxY中class2的文件移动到当前用户桌面的CLASS2中
	# mkdir CLASS2
	# mv study/WESTOS_class2_linux{1..6}

  • 备份/etc目录中所有带名字带有数字并且以.conf结尾的文件到桌面上的confdir中
	# mkdir confdir
	# cp /etc/*[[:digit:]]*.conf confdir
  • 删掉刚才建立或备份的所有文件
	# rm -rf *
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值